Charlotte Motor Speedway
Coca Cola 600
May 29, 2011
Harvick wins at Charlotte: #29-Kevin Harvick won the Coca Cola 600 Sprint Cup Series race at Charlotte Motor Speedway for his 3rd win of 2011 and 17th win of his career. #6-Ragan [best career finish] finished second followed by #20-Logano, #22-Busch, #43-Allmendinger, #9-Ambrose, #88-Earnhardt Jr. [who led, ran out of fuel in 4th turn], #78-Smith, #00-Reutimann and #11-Hamlin. #48-Johnson lost an engine with a few laps to go, setting up a green-white-checker finish. #4-Kahne led on the final restart and immediately ran out of fuel. The points leader, #99-Edwards, finished 16th and increased his points lead to 36 points over #29-Harvick who moves into 2nd
There were 38 lead changes among 19 drivers; 14 cautions for 64 yellow flag laps. The attendance is listed as 145,000 up from 140,000 last year.

Race Comments: Before a crowd estimated at 145,000, Kevin Harvick won the Coca-Cola 600, his 17th NASCAR Sprint Cup Series victory.
Prior to the green flag, the following cars dropped to the rear: #60 (back-up car), #78 and #09 (transmission).
TIME OF RACE:4 hours, 33 minutes, 14 seconds
AVERAGE SPEED:132.414 mph
MARGIN OF VICTORY:0.703 second(s)

Driver Rating: Formula combining the following categories: Win, Finish, Top-15 Finish, Average Running Position While on Lead Lap, Average Speed Under Green, Fastest Lap, Led Most Laps, Lead-Lap Finish. Maximum: 150 points per race. Must have raced in 75% of scheduled point-paying races.
